Why Choose All Systems for Reznor Unit Heater Installation in East Kingston
Reznor unit heaters are mounted directly in the space they heat, making them ideal for industrial and commercial applications in East Kingston where installation simplicity and heating efficiency matter. During the assessment phase, we calculate the heating load based on building size, insulation, outdoor temperatures typical for NY, and intended use. Once we determine the right unit size and fuel type for gas fired or electric operation, we handle all structural mounting, proper placement for airflow coverage, and secure installation to prevent vibration and noise. For gas-fired models, we install vent piping to code, perform a full pressure test, and verify proper combustion. For electric units, we run dedicated circuits and confirm safe electrical operation. After installation, we test the thermostat operation, confirm even heat distribution across the space, adjust burner settings if needed, and walk you through basic maintenance requirements. The entire process takes one to three days depending on space size and complexity of venting requirements.

Load Calculation and Unit Sizing
We perform a detailed heating load assessment using your space dimensions, insulation levels, climate conditions in Ulster County, and usage patterns. Oversizing wastes energy and money; undersizing leaves areas cold. Our calculations ensure the Reznor unit delivers the heating capacity you need without excess cycling.

Professional Gas and Electrical Hookup
Gas-fired units require proper vent pipe installation, pressure testing, and combustion verification. Electric units need dedicated circuits and safe wiring to code. We handle the full hookup from fuel or power source to the unit itself, ensuring all connections meet local codes.

Balanced Heat Distribution and Commissioning
Unit placement and mounting directly affect how evenly heat spreads across your space. We position units to minimize dead spots and hot zones, then commission the system with full testing of thermostat response, burner operation, and airflow patterns before we leave.
